About tert-butyl (2'S,7R)-2-chloro-4-(difluoromethyl)-4-hydroxy-2'-methylspiro[5H-thieno[2,3-c]pyran-7,4'-piperidine]-1'-carboxylate

tert-butyl (2'S,7R)-2-chloro-4-(difluoromethyl)-4-hydroxy-2'-methylspiro[5H-thieno[2,3-c]pyran-7,4'-piperidine]-1'-carboxylate (PubChem CID 169140410) has the molecular formula C18H24ClF2NO4S and a molecular weight of 423.91 g/mol. Its IUPAC name is tert-butyl (2'S,7R)-2-chloro-4-(difluoromethyl)-4-hydroxy-2'-methylspiro[5H-thieno[2,3-c]pyran-7,4'-piperidine]-1'-carboxylate.
